Hyper-personalization is becoming a popular term in the collections and recovery space. It represents an enhanced form of personalization that takes advantage of AI capabilities to provide a seamlessly data-driven and truly humanized collections journey.
Improved collection experiences directly lead to an increased likelihood of resolved debt. Not only are your customers more likely to engage with you again after they become current, but you’ll be better informed to develop personalized solutions through the increase of available data.

Data management in traditional collections processes is time consuming. Teams need to procure information from different sources (specific departments, third parties, storage locations) and then perform manual analysis to inform their engagement with each customer.
